Junior Officers, I need to know which of you can attend the guild event for sure (Sunday 15th, 6pm server time tentative) - we need to see who we have available, match them up with an event or two, and make sure we have a few spare people to hand in case someone can't show up.

Also - (and this goes out to regular guild members too!) We want the prizes this time around to be even better than last time, and they have to come from somewhere! Are you an AH junkie, and can spare some gold or sweet items as prizes? Can you craft something unique, rare, or otherwise valuable, that you'd be willing to donate as a prize? Have a line on some sweet pets, or interesting trinkets? Please let me know if you can (we need all the help we can get, so it's not just a few of us paying for everything :D ).

Please mail me (Surii) your donation, with the subject EVENT DONATION, and we'll be sure that it becomes part of a prize - we really will appreciate all the help you guys can offer - dig deep! We want to make this one extra-special, so every little bit helps!

Oh - totally. I can move the thread to the backend somewhere, or physically delete the entire thing. But that goes against the forum policies. With the exception of individual forum-related business (where applicable), it is understood that threads and posts are never removed, edited, or deleted. The idea is to let everything sit as it 'was'; an accurate record of what went down, and it keeps people from crying 'he changed the post' whenever it's convenient.

If something is said here, it pretty much *stays* here, unless the author himself changes his post before the 'timer' expires (iirc messages after a certain point can no longer be edited by the author).
